 
/* 
title: AdinfoNepal, Nepal.
xhtml/css author: Shreeram thapaliya
date: march 2010
document: master stylesheet
*/
 

 
/* Reset */
html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,a, abbr, acronym, address, big, cite, code,del, dfn, font, ins, kbd, q, s, samp,small, strike, tt, var,dl, dt, dd, ul, li,fieldset, form, label, legend,table, caption, tbody, tfoot, thead, tr, th, td {	margin: 0;	padding: 0;	border: 0;	outline: 0;	font-weight: inherit;	font-style: inherit;	font-size: 100%;	font-family: inherit;	vertical-align: baseline;}body {	line-height: 1;	color: black;	background: white;} ul {	list-style: none;}/* tables still need 'cellspacing="0"' in the markup */table {	border-collapse: separate;	border-spacing: 0;}caption, th, td {	text-align: left;	font-weight: normal;}blockquote:before, blockquote:after,q:before, q:after {	content: "";}blockquote, q {	quotes: "" "";}
 
/******************
Overall Site Styles
******************/
 
/* HTML Elements */

#slogan
{
margin-left:20px;
margin-top:20px;
}


{
	margin:0;
	padding:0;
	}
 

 
body {

	font: 100% Arial, Helvetica;
	color:#241903;

	background-image: url(images/bodybg.jpg);
	background-repeat: repeat;

}
 
 
 
 
 
strong{font-weight:800;}
p
{
padding-bottom:1em;
line-height:18px;
text-align:justify;
word-spacing:0.5px;
font-family: "Trebuchet MS", "Times New Roman", Times, serif;
font-size:12px;
}
 
 .p
{
padding-bottom:1em;
line-height:18px;
text-align:justify;
word-spacing:0.5px;
font-family: "Trebuchet MS", "Times New Roman", Times, serif;
font-size:12px;
}
h1{
	font-size:20px;
	font-family: "Trebuchet MS", "Times New Roman", Times, serif;
	font-weight: normal;
	color:#A72C31;
	padding:0px;
	margin:0px;
	text-align:left;

	
	
	}
	
#mainmenu h1{
	font-size:20px;
	font-family: "Trebuchet MS", "Times New Roman", Times, serif;
	font-weight: normal;
	color:#789498;
	padding-bottom:0.5em;
	font-style: italic;
	}
 
 
h2{
	font-size:14px;
	font-family: "Trebuchet MS", "Times New Roman", Times, serif;
	font-weight: 500px;
	padding-bottom: 5px;

	color:#A72C31;
	}
	
	
	.h2{
	font-size:14px;
	font-family: "Trebuchet MS", "Times New Roman", Times, serif;
	font-weight:700;
	padding-bottom: 5px;
	color:#FFFFFF;
	}
 
#mainmenu h2{
	font-size:14px;
	font-family: "Trebuchet MS", "Times New Roman", Times, serif;
	font-weight: normal;
	color:#964415;
	padding-bottom:0.5em;
	font-style: italic;
	}
	
 
h3{
	font-family: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ight: bold;
	color: #964415;
	background:#d3d3d3;
	}
	
	
	.firstline
	{
	background:url(images/toplast1.gif);
	width:1003px;
	height:30px;
	
	}

.bannarflash
{
width:1003px;
background:#241903;

height:204px;

}

.bannarflashleft
{
background:#241903;
width:382px;
float:left;


}


.bannarflashright
{
background:#241903;
width:382px;
float:left;


}
	
.clearer {clear: both;}
 
/* Links */
a:link{color:#431903;text-decoration:none;}
a:visited{color:#431903;text-decoration:none;}
a:hover{color:#F7941D;text-decoration:none;}
a:active{color:#F7941D;text-decoration:underline;}
 
/* menu */
.pic
{
float:left;
clear:left;
margin-bottom:5px;

}

.pic2
{
float:right;
clear:right;

margin-bottom:5px;
}
 
.timeanddategiver
{
 
padding-top:4px;
margin-top:10px;
margin-left:700px;
width:300px;
height:20px;
float:left;
 
 
}
.toplast
{
background:url(images/toplast.gif);
width:1003px;
height:34px;

}
.holewebcontroler
{

width:1003px;
float:left;

}




#mainbody
{
background:#d3d3d3;
float:none;
margin-top:15px;
width:1003px;


}



 .topround
 {
 background:url(images/toprounded.gif);
 background-repeat:no-repeat;
 width:1003px;
 height:52px;
 float:left;
 }
 /* body */
 

 .bodycontroler
 {

 width:1003px;
 float:left;
  z-index:10;
  background:#d3d3d3;
  padding-top:10px;

 }
 
 .leftbar
 {
 margin-left:5px;
 width:130px;
 float:left;
 background:#999999;
 

 }
 
 .middlebar
 {
 width:568px;
 margin-left:5px;
 float:left;


 z-index:10;
 }
 .firstmiddlebar
 {
 background:url(images/15.gif);
 height:38px;
 width:568px;
 float:left;
  z-index:10;
 }
 
 .secondmiddlebar
 {
 background:#eaeaea;
 width:558px;
 padding:5px;
 float:left;
 z-index:10;
 }
 
secondmiddlebartext
{
width:558px;
 padding:5px;
}

 
 .specialoffer
 {
 background:#eaeaea;
 width:558px;
  padding:5px;
 }

 
 .secondmiddlebar ul
 {
 list-style-type:none;
 padding:0px;
 margin:0px;
 }
 
 .secondmiddlebar ul li
 {


margin-left:20px;
margin-bottom:10px;
width:250px;
line-height:18px;
text-align:justify;
word-spacing:1px;
font-weight:500px;
font-family: "Trebuchet MS", "Times New Roman", Times, serif;
font-size:14px;
float:left;
 }
 
 .thirdmiddlebar
 {
 background:url(images/14.gif);
 height:38px;
 width:568px;
 float:left;
 z-index:10;
 }
 .rightbar
 {
 width:280px;
 margin-left:10px;
 float:right;
 background:#ebebeb;
 }
 .rightbartwo
 {
 background:url(images/righttopimg.gif);
 width:280px;
 height:36px;
  }
 
.imagecontroler
{
float:right;
padding-left:10px;
padding-right:10px;
width:260px;
}


.imageguilder

{
padding-left:3px;
padding-bottom:5px;
float:left;

height:125px;
}
.abouadinfo
{
width:270px;
padding:5px;
background:#ebebeb;
float:left;

}

.abouadinfo ul
{
padding:0px;
margin:0px;
text-align:center;
}
.abouadinfo ul li
{
background:#990000;
padding:4px 15px 5px 15px;
text-align:center;
}


.background
{
width:115px;
margin:0px;
background:#990000;
padding:4px 15px 5px 25px;
text-align:center;
}

.links
{

	width:280px;
	background:#ebebeb;
	float:left;
	border-top:#999999 1px dashed;


}
.leftlinks
{
widows:220px;
float:left;
padding:9px;
border-right:#999999 1px dotted;
border-left:#999999 1px dotted;
}
.text
{
color:#FFFFFF;
font-family:"Trebuchet MS", "Times New Roman", "Tempus Sans ITC";
font-size:13px;
font-weight:800;
}

.leftlinks ul
{
padding:0px;
margin:0px;
list-style-type:none;

}
.leftlinks ul li
{
font-family:"Trebuchet MS", "Tw Cen MT", Tahoma;
font-size:12px;
text-align:left;
padding:2px 0 0 5px;
display:block;
border-bottom:#d3d3d3 1px dashed;
}


.rightlinks
{

padding:9px;
widows:220px;
float:left;
border-right:#999999 1px dotted;
}
.rightlinks ul
{
padding:0px;
margin:0px;
list-style-type:none;
}

.rightlinks ul li
{
font-family:"Trebuchet MS", "Tw Cen MT", Tahoma;
font-size:12px;
text-align:left;
padding:2px 0 0 5px;
display:block;
border-bottom:#d3d3d3 1px dashed;
}
.linkafterbannar
{
background:#ebebeb;
width:260px;
float:left;
padding:10px;
}
.text2
{
background:#990000;
padding:5px;
color:#FFFFFF;
font-weight:900;
}


/* Footer */
#footer {
width:1003px;
	clear: both;
	background-color: #9D2929;
	background-image: url(images/footerredbg.jpg);
	background-repeat: repeat-x;
	background-position: left bottom;
	text-align: center;
	padding-bottom: 15px;
	}
#insidefooter {
width:1003px;
	margin: 0 auto;
	text-align: left;
	padding-top: 20px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#F5CDAA;
	}
#insidefooter p {
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-style: italic;
	font-size: 11px;
	color: #F5CDAA;
	}
#insidefooter ul {
	padding: 0;
	margin: 0;
}
 
#insidefooter ul li {
	width: 180px;
	display: block;
}
 
#insidefooter ul li a {
	color: #F5CDAA;
	text-indent: 10px;
	display: block;
	height: 22px;
	line-height: 22px;
	text-decoration: none;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#CA6C18;
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-style: italic;
	}
#insidefooter ul li a:hover {
	color: #fff;
	background-color: #CA6C18;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#7F2124;
		}
#insidefooter ul#footermenuone {
	float: left;
	margin-right: 40px;
}
#insidefooter ul#footermenutwo {
	float: left;
	margin-right: 40px;
}
#insidefooter ul#footermenutwo li a {
	border-bottom-color: #CA6C18;
}
 
#insidefooter ul#footermenutwo li a:hover {
	background-color: #CA6C18;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#7F2124;
}
 
#insidefooter ul#footermenuthree li a {
	border-bottom-color: #CA6C18;
}
#insidefooter ul#footermenuthree li a:hover {
	background-color: #CA6C18;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#7F2124;
}
 
#insidefooter ul#footermenuthree {
	float: left;
	margin-right: 20px;
}
 
.leftfooter {
	float: left;
}
.rightfooter {
	float: left;
	color: #855e47;
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-style: italic;
}

 
#footer .rightfooter a{
	color: #855e47;
}
#footer .rightfooter a:hover{
	color: #ffe4b8;
}
 
* Float Properties*/
 
.clearfloat:after {
	content:".";
	display:block;
	height:0;
	clear:both;
	visibility:hidden;
	}
 
.clearfloat {
	display: inline-block;
	}
 
 
/* Hides from IE-mac \*/
* html .clearfloat {
	height:1%;
	}
 
*+html .clearfloat {
	height:1%;
	}
 
.clearfloat {
	display:block;
	}
 
 
/* page navigation */
 
.wp-pagenavi a, .wp-pagenavi a:link {
	padding: 2px 4px 2px 4px; 
	margin: 2px;
	text-decoration: none;
	border: 1px solid #A72C31;
	color: #0066cc;
	background-color: #FFFFFF;	
}
.wp-pagenavi a:visited {
	padding: 2px 4px 2px 4px; 
	margin: 2px;
	text-decoration: none;
	border: 1px solid #A72C31;
	color: #0066cc;
	background-color: #FFFFFF;	
}
.wp-pagenavi a:hover {	
	border: 1px solid #000000;
	color: #fff;
	background-color: #A72C31;
}
.wp-pagenavi a:active {
	padding: 2px 4px 2px 4px; 
	margin: 2px;
	text-decoration: none;
	border: 1px solid #0066cc;
	color: #0066cc;
	background-color: #A72C31;	
}
.wp-pagenavi span.pages {
	padding: 2px 4px 2px 4px; 
	margin: 2px 2px 2px 2px;
	color: #000000;
	border: 1px solid #000000;
	background-color: #FFFFFF;
}
.wp-pagenavi span.current {
	padding: 2px 4px 2px 4px; 
	margin: 2px;
	font-weight: bold;
	border: 1px solid #000000;
	color: #000000;
	background-color: #FFFFFF;
}
.wp-pagenavi span.extend {
	padding: 2px 4px 2px 4px; 
	margin: 2px;	
	border: 1px solid #000000;
	color: #000000;
	background-color: #FFFFFF;
}
